Crafting the Perfect Out-of-Office SMS for Professionals

Crafting an effective out-of-office SMS is essential in maintaining professionalism and communication standards while away from work. Studies show that a well-crafted message can leave a lasting impression on colleagues, clients, and stakeholders. To ensure your out-of-office SMS strikes the right balance, consider the following tips:

  • Be Clear and Concise: Clearly state your unavailability dates and provide an alternative contact person if necessary.
  • Express Gratitude: Show appreciation for the understanding and assure recipients that their needs will be addressed promptly upon your return.
  • Set Expectations: Manage expectations by informing recipients when they can anticipate a response or when you’ll be back in the office.
  • Personalize Your Message: Adding a personal touch can make your SMS more engaging. Consider incorporating a friendly tone while maintaining professionalism.

Importance of Setting Clear Expectations

Conveying Availability

When crafting an out-of-office SMS, clearly stating my unavailability dates is crucial. It helps colleagues, clients, and stakeholders know when they can expect my return and plan accordingly. Being specific about my absence dates avoids any confusion and ensures that everyone is informed.

Providing Alternative Contacts

In my out-of-office message, Providing Alternative Contacts is essential. This enables individuals to reach out to someone else for immediate assistance if needed. Including alternative contacts shows that I value their needs and helps maintain smooth communication in my absence.

Remember, setting clear expectations in my out-of-office SMS is key to ensuring that everyone knows what to expect during my absence.
